Supporting UK armed forces by upgrading satellite communications

We are pleased to announce the completion of a large fibre optic installation in support of the UK armed forces sat comm networks.

Due to our long standing relationship with the various agencies working on the SKYNET 5 PFI Purple Communications was selected as the prime fibre optic contractor to be part of a large upgrade to the UK's military communications network.

This project involved us working in partnership with EADS Astrium, Paradigm Communications and Serco to provide a new satellite receiving dish and associated equipment at a ground station in Wiltshire.

Our role was to provide all the fibre optic connectivity between the new dish and the purpose built data centre, we supplied and installed a mixture of multimode and singlemode fibre with LC and FC/APC patch panels.

We then set about terminating over 1000 fibre optic ends and providing certification using power loss and OTDR testing.
